Summary of the Recent Myanmar Earthquake Incident and Responses
On March 28, 2025, a devastating earthquake struck Myanmar, resulting in significant loss of life and numerous injuries. The calamity prompted widespread condolences and calls for support from around the world. Anoop Nautiyal, a prominent figure on Twitter, expressed his heartfelt sympathies for the victims and their families in a tweet that resonated with many. He highlighted the urgency of the situation and the pressing need for assistance for those affected by the disaster.
